Lelia Coates

Jan 7, 1921 — Jun 27, 2017

Lelia Slusher Coates, 95, went to her heavenly home Tuesday, June 27, 2017. She was preceded in death by her husband, George Coates; two special nephews, Danny and Jimmy Boothe; parents, William and Louise Slusher; brothers, Bill, Joe, Leo, Lewis and Tom Slusher; and two sisters, Betty Nester and Julia Ann Slusher.   Lelia is survived by her brother and sister-in-law, Bud and Betty Slusher; a sister, Hazel Rutrough; sisters-in-law, Juanita Slusher and Phyllis Slusher, and brother-in-law, Bob Nester; and many nieces and nephews. Also surviving are dear friends and caregivers, Randy Vasold and Ella Indge.   Lelia enjoyed a full and happy life with her work at C&P Telephone Co, traveling with her husband, golf, and in later years became a very talented artist.  She was a member of St. Luke's United Methodist Church.   She also served in the United States Army as a WAC.   There will be a graveside service at 1 p.m. on Saturday, July 1, 2017, at Mountain View Cemetery with the Reverend Susan Hannah and the Reverend Jessica Slusher officiating.  A visitation will be held from 11:30 a.m. to 12:30 p.m. at Townes Funeral Home prior to the service.
